DESTINATION TORONTO WINS GOLD STELLA AWARD!

Destination Toronto has been awarded the GOLD Stella Award as the Best CVB/DMO in the International and US Territories Category by Northstar Meetings Group. Finalists were determined by meeting and event planners during an open voting period and winners were chosen by an expert panel of judges selected by the editors of Northstar Meetings Group. Winners will officially be announced by Northstar on November 3rd and will be featured in a special supplement in the November/December 2022 issue of Meetings & Conventions.   • The Toronto Inc team is attending WebSummit, the largest global tech conference and the European edition of Collision, hosted annually in Toronto. The Canadian delegation is nearly 300 people including the Toronto Inc partners, who are delivering a strong, combined Toronto presence on site for more than 70,000 delegates. 
  • Look for an elevated sense of arrival and of Toronto at Toronto Pearson Airport later this month, as a major new photographic installation is completed in Terminals 1 and 3 arrivals areas. Featuring 24 large-format photographs - some more than 40 feet across and also including sliding doors that every traveler passes through - the installation will create a more impactful arrival for visitors and immediately invite them to explore and experience more of the destination. This project was initiated by DT in partnership with RTO partners in Toronto, Mississauga and Brampton, and of course with close collaboration with the GTAA.

POCKET PILLS

A new service has been added to the Group Benefits called PocketPills. 

PocketPills is an online pharmacy that helps you manage your prescriptions and medications for you or your dependents medications.

The service offers: free delivery, reduced dispensing fee of $7, access to a pharmacist 24x7, a mobile app to easily refill subscriptions, an easy process for transferring over prescriptions from your existing pharmacy, and more.
